DESCRIPTION
“Bigger Leaner Stronger: The Simple Science of Building the Ultimate Male Body” presents a straightforward, science-backed blueprint for men who want to build muscle, lose fat, and transform their physique—without wasting endless hours in the gym or breaking the bank on supplements. Michael Matthews writes in a confident, no-nonsense voice that cuts through the clutter of fitness myths and industry hype. He emphasizes that muscle growth and fat loss hinge on consistent strength training, progressive overload, and sensible nutrition—not exotic routines, “muscle confusion,” or extreme diets.
Matthews is not just another trainer pushing gimmicks. He is a certified personal trainer, bestselling author, and founder of Muscle for Life and Legion Athletics. With nearly two decades of training experience and over 1.5 million books sold worldwide, he uses his own transformation journey—one filled with trial, error, and scientific inquiry—to anchor the principles in this book. His credentials include working with thousands of clients, reviewing hundreds of peer-reviewed studies, and his writing appearing in outlets like Men’s Health, Esquire, and FOX.
The book is structured in clear, logical sections. It debunks ten harmful fitness myths—like “you need cardio to lose fat” or “carbs make you fat”—and explains the core drivers of muscular hypertrophy. Nutrition chapters guide the reader in creating flexible meal plans that include pizza and ice cream while still promoting fat loss. A year‑long workout program outlines optimal routines using compound exercises, progressive overload, and recovery strategies, all designed to be completed in just 3–5 hours per week.
Supplement advice is clear and pragmatic: avoid marketing fluff, and rely only on research-backed essentials. The result is a no‑BS guide that empowers men of all ages and experience levels to build a lean, strong body sustainably. It’s currently in its fourth edition (2023), ensuring it stays aligned with the latest scientific findings .
